According to market schedules, Rail Vikas Nigam, Suzlon Energy, Oil and Natural Gas Corporation, IRCTC (Indian Railway Catering & Tourism Corp), GMR Airports, and Interglobe Aviation (the parent company of IndiGo) are among the firms set to report their Q4 2026 earnings next week. The full list also includes several other notable entities, though the exact reporting dates may vary by company. These quarterly announcements are closely watched by market participants as they reflect the operational performance and financial outcomes of India’s leading public and private sector enterprises. For instance, RVNL is a key player in railway infrastructure projects, while ONGC is the country’s largest crude oil and natural gas producer. Suzlon Energy operates in the renewable energy space, and IRCTC manages the ticketing and catering operations for Indian Railways. GMR Airports handles major airport concessions, and IndiGo is one of India’s largest airlines. The earnings releases are expected to cover revenue, profit margins, and other key metrics for the quarter ended March 2026.

The upcoming Q4 results may provide valuable insights into the performance trajectory of India’s core industries. Infrastructure-related firms like RVNL could reflect the pace of government spending on railway modernization, while energy companies such as ONGC may be influenced by global crude price volatility and domestic demand. Suzlon Energy’s results might be shaped by the expansion of renewable energy capacity and policy support. In the aviation and travel sector, IndiGo and GMR Airports could reveal the impact of passenger traffic trends, fuel costs, and operational efficiency. IRCTC’s numbers would likely be tied to railway travel demand and catering revenues. Collectively, these earnings reports could signal how different sectors are navigating macroeconomic headwinds, including inflation and interest rate changes. However, actual outcomes depend on company-specific factors and broader economic conditions.
